The Systemair CBM 250-6,0 duct heater is a high-performance round electric heater designed for standard spiral circular ducts, delivering 6kW of reliable heat with a 400V 2-phase power supply. Built from durable Aluzinc-coated sheet steel with stainless steel heating elements, this unit ensures long-lasting performance and minimal maintenance. Its integrated electronic temperature regulator uses time-proportional Pulse/Pause technology for precise, silent, and wear-free operation, while rubber-sealed spigots prevent leaks. The temperature is easily adjustable via the heater cover, and terminals allow interlocking with pressure- and airflow guards. Suitable for a maximum output air temperature of 50°C, it operates efficiently at a minimum airflow of 280m³/h.
